Top 10 Proven Tips to Improve Concentration While Studying
1. Set Clear Study Goals Write down exactly what you plan to study in the next 1 hour. A clear goal gives your mind direction.
2. Use the Pomodoro Technique Study for 25 minutes, then take a 5-minute break. Repeat this 4 times and then take a longer 15-20 minute break.
3. Create a Distraction-Free Study Zone Choose a clean, quiet place to study. Keep your phone in silent mode or use apps like Forest or Focus To-Do.
4. Avoid Multitasking Focus on one subject or topic at a time. Switching between tasks reduces concentration.
5. Take Regular Brain Breaks After every 45-60 minutes of studying, get up, stretch, walk around, or drink water. This resets your brain.
6. Practice Mindfulness or Meditation Just 5-10 minutes of daily meditation improves attention span and reduces mental clutter.
7. Get Enough Sleep (7–8 hours) Lack of sleep is one of the biggest reasons for poor focus. Your brain needs rest to retain and process information.
8. Use Background Study Music Try low-volume instrumental music or white noise to reduce external distractions.
9. Eat Brain-Boosting Foods Nuts, blueberries, dark chocolate, and green tea can improve memory and concentration.
10. Reward Yourself After every completed session, give yourself a small reward – snack, short video, or walk.

FAQs – AskNowHub Answers
Q: What should I do if my mind wanders every 5 minutes? A: Reduce distractions. Try shorter Pomodoro sessions (15 mins study, 3 mins break) and gradually increase.
Q: Is it okay to listen to music while studying? A: Yes, if it’s instrumental or lo-fi. Avoid lyrics as they can distract the brain.
Q: How long should I study at a stretch? A: 45–60 minutes per session with 10-minute breaks works best for most students.
Q: Does exercise help concentration? A: Absolutely. 20 minutes of walking or light cardio increases blood flow to the brain.
